Behavior Analyst Intern information

Is there a demand for behavior analyst interns?

There is a growing demand for behavior analyst interns as the field of applied behavior analysis expands, especially for those pursuing certification and gaining practical experience. Internships often serve as a stepping stone toward becoming a licensed behavior analyst, with opportunities available in healthcare, education, and community settings.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a behavior analyst intern?

To thrive as a Behavior Analyst Intern, you need foundational knowledge of applied behavior analysis (ABA), coursework toward BCBA certification, and experience working with individuals with behavioral challenges. Familiarity with data collection tools, ABA software systems, and direct observation techniques is typically required. Strong communication, patience, and a collaborative attitude are essential soft skills for supporting clients and coordinating with supervisors. These skills are crucial for effective intervention implementation, accurate data analysis, and fostering positive client outcomes in behavioral health settings.

What does a behavior analyst intern do?

A Behavior Analyst Intern assists in the assessment and implementation of behavior intervention plans under the supervision of a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A). Their responsibilities often include collecting and analyzing data, observing clients, implementing behavior modification strategies, and participating in team meetings. The goal is to gain practical experience and develop skills necessary for a future career as a certified behavior analyst. Interns usually work with individuals who have autism or other developmental disorders and help support positive behavior changes.

What is the difference between Behavior Analyst Intern vs Behavior Therapist?

AspectBehavior Analyst InternBehavior Therapist
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ing BCBA or related certification, some supervised experienceUsually certified or registered, such as RBT or similar
Work EnvironmentClinical settings, schools, or research environmentsTherapy sessions, schools, clinics, home-based settings
Employer & Industry UsageBehavior analysis clinics, educational programs, research institutionsBehavioral health agencies, schools, private practices

Behavior Analyst Interns are often students working towards certification, gaining supervised experience in clinical or educational settings. Behavior Therapists are typically certified practitioners providing direct therapy services. While both roles focus on behavior modification, Interns are in training, whereas Therapists are practicing professionals.

Job description

POSITION SUMMARY

The Electrical Engineering Intern will support the development, testing, validation, and documentation of lithium-ion battery energy storage products used in critical power applications. Working alongside experienced electrical, mechanical, firmware, quality, and manufacturing engineers, the intern will gain hands-on experience with battery systems, battery management systems (BMS), electrical test equipment, and new product development processes.

The successful candidate will contribute to engineering projects involving battery cabinets, power electronics, electrical controls, safety compliance, and product validation while developing practical engineering skills in a fast-paced product development environment. This role is ideal for students interested in energy storage, power systems, renewable energy integration, and critical infrastructure.

RESPONSIBILITIES

Assist engineers with electrical testing and validation of battery energy storage systems and associated electronics.

Support creation and execution of test plans, data collection, and analysis of test results.

Read and interpret electrical schematics, wiring diagrams, and assembly drawings.

Assist with troubleshooting electrical, communication, and integration issues during product development and testing.

Support development and review of engineering documentation, specifications, procedures, and test reports.

Help evaluate electrical components, sensors, cables, connectors, and battery management system hardware.

Participate in prototype assembly and laboratory testing activities.

Assist with sustaining engineering projects, including component substitutions and design improvement initiatives.

Collaborate with cross-functional teams including manufacturing, sourcing, quality, and product management.

Support compliance and certification activities related to UL, CSA, IEC, and other applicable standards.

Maintain safe laboratory practices and follow company safety procedures.
